Transaction 64d73090cbfdf90d84c712ddb680edefb495a9bb3597bd3bc5ddea5e92967686
2 Input
2 Outputs
- 64d73090cbfdf90d84c712ddb680edefb495a9bb3597bd3bc5ddea5e92967686:0
- 64d73090cbfdf90d84c712ddb680edefb495a9bb3597bd3bc5ddea5e92967686:1
value 17371
address 1NonUtLhb6qFUxrQqD4C4zpgrr1Ro4zFeG
value 189180
address 3Cu1ZtBkWDebjTNa2eMPqjtjUbRLEKYSND